Overview & Vibe
The Fig Tree is the quintessential Byron wedding — a hinterland estate at Ewingsdale where a 150-year-old Moreton Bay fig throws its canopy over the ceremony and the view rolls down green hills to the ocean, Cape Byron and the lighthouse.
Setting & Style
Vows happen in the garden beneath the ancient fig, cocktails drift to the pool area and through the olive grove, and receptions fill the restaurant's white-draped, floor-to-ceiling-windowed rooms in the old farmhouse. The kitchen runs dedicated wedding menus — including a full vegan and vegetarian menu — with a BYO drinks policy that keeps the bar personal, and a wedding tasting experience before the day. Two luxurious on-site homes, Sunrise House and The Dairy, sleep the wedding party, with breakfast delivered on the morning of.
Ideal For
Couples chasing the classic Byron picture — fig-tree vows, hinterland light and an ocean horizon behind the portraits.
